... T192 ~ T255 (64 points) C C000 ~ C255 (256 points) Counter S S00.00 ~ S99.99 (100×100 steps) Step controller D D0000 ~ D4999 (5,000 words) Data register Operation modes RUN, STOP, PAUSE, DEBUG Self-diagnosis ... with the same data • Force I/O data will not be cleared even in the STOP mode • If a program is downloaded or its backup breaks, the force on/off setting data will be cleared The oper ating program ... Counter elapsed value T000 T191 T192 (256 words) Counter preset value “F” “T” (256 words) Step Controller (100 x 100 steps) S99 S00.00~S99.99 Timer relay (10ms) 64 points “T” Counter relay C255...
... ladder logic to be used, for the aforementioned reasons Newer formats such as State Logic and Function Block (which is similar to the way logic is depicted when using digital integrated logic ... popular as ladder logic A primary reason for this is that PLCs solve the logic in a predictable and repeating sequence, and ladder logic allows the programmer (the person writing the logic) to see ... desktop based logic, operating systems such as Windows not lend themselves to deterministic logic execution, with the result that the logic may not always respond to changes in logic state or...
... build controlled Most modern controllers use a com- plc wiring - 1.3 puter to achieve control The most flexible of these controllers is the PLC (Programmable Logic Controller)
... this way, the design-simulation cycle is done iteratively for error-free control logic 8 ProgrammableLogicController Fig Extended activity diagram for use case in Figure of example prototype ... macro block is built including precedent or succeeding logic flow transition Later, a macro block is substituted by one of 14 ProgrammableLogicController ladder lung pattern Fig 12 shows the example ... generation for PLC controllers, LNCS 3688, pp.303-316 Spath D., and Osmers U (1996) Virtual reality- an approach to improve the generation of fault free software for programmablelogic controllers,...
... exception specification 28 ProgrammableLogicController The specification language is based on IEC 61131-3 (all four languages but not SFC) and Linear Temporal Logic (LTL), see for instance ... when the timer has reached the value of TimeValue the TimeOutFwd output goes high 22 ProgrammableLogicController Fig The principle of controlling two parallel clamps at Company To increase ... FB_Alarm_Clamps sends an alarm for that clamp The AND operator is used to assure that 24 ProgrammableLogicController both clamps are closed and not open In the figure all FBs for one clamp and...
... machines and industrial processes Considering an industrial automation process based on ProgrammableLogic Controllers (PLC), the sensors are installed in the plant and generate events that represent ... stages; and agile methods, which emerged in the 1990 Examples of the latter are: Adaptive 34 ProgrammableLogicController Software Development, Crystal, Dynamic Systems Development, eXtreme Programming ... Statecharts is more restrictive than that of UML/Statecharts to avoid conflict and 36 ProgrammableLogicController inconsistency in model evolution We believe that this semantic is more appropriate...
... 64 ProgrammableLogicController Fig Human Machine Interface In our practical application, the decomposition is straightforward; there are separate subnets for each station Thus, the local controllers ... local controllers are instances of descendants of those abstract classes For example, Fig shows the classes in the control of the manufacturing cell that are The Java based ProgrammableLogicController ... architecture To synchronize the local controller s execution with the reading/writing of data in the field bus, a semaphore for each controller is used The local controllers are cyclical but, at the...
... 72 ProgrammableLogicController system However, because the behaviour of a production order depends on the ... automatically switching between hierarchical and heterarchical operating mode; (ii) the 74 ProgrammableLogicController definition of the holarchy and set up of the holon structures; (iii) the design ... supply; automatic generation of self-supply tasks upon detecting local storage depletion, 76 ProgrammableLogicController • In line vision-based parts qualifying and quality control of products in...
... management application and the client Fig 10 presents the application modules These are: 86 ProgrammableLogicController Authentication Administration commands module Workcell interfacing module User ... for each robot before the task could be executed once the item arrives at the station 88 ProgrammableLogicController Step 2.3: Choose the operation with the smallest waiting time and introduce ... to high-priority batch orders A FailureManager was created for managing changes in 90 ProgrammableLogicController resource status A virtually identical counterpart, the RecoveryManager, takes...
... 98 ProgrammableLogicController Okino, N., 1993 Bionic Manufacturing System in Flexible Manufacturing System: ... Suzuki Nagoya University Japan Introduction Event-driven controlled systems based on the ProgrammableLogicController (PLC) are widely used in many industrial processes The number of such a control ... diagnosis performance strongly depend on the complexity of the graph structure of BN 100 ProgrammableLogicController This chapter also addresses a design method of the graph structure of the BN...
... way of controlling these noise levels across both access networks Programmablelogic controllers (PLCs) are the main types of controllers used within the industry One of their characteristics ... subsystem is specified in Table Fig 14 Diagram of transfer line and definition of events 114 ProgrammableLogicController Table Set of events in each subsystem The control lows applied to the system ... form of a ladder logic ? For example, Fig.15 shows the ladder logic of the C1 wherein the operating situation of the Lane1 (L1) is expressed by L1 = (X ∨ L1) ∧ In other case, the logic of the C4...
... on a personal computer 128 ProgrammableLogicController Fig Example of PLC application on WBN (a) 129 New Applications Using PLCs in Access Networks (b) Fig Ladder logic program for stepper motor ... Ethernet The control program is downloaded into the controller The logic programming for service substation and customer service substation is almost identical The logic programming is configured ... 124 ProgrammableLogicController • A wireless metropolitan area network (WMAN) is a data network that may cover...